Fun & Interactive Halloween Content Ideas

Costume & Photo Contests

Nothing gets people more engaged than a good old-fashioned competition. Here are some brilliant ideas to get your audience participating:

• Host a Halloween throwback photo contest encouraging customers to share childhood costume photos
• Run a current costume contest where participants submit their best Halloween looks using your branded hashtag
• Create a spooky home decoration contest featuring customers' Halloween displays
• Launch a pumpkin carving competition with prizes for most creative, scariest, and funniest categories
• Host a "Best Halloween Pet" contest – people absolutely love showing off their furry friends in costumes

Interactive Entertainment Posts

Keep your followers entertained throughout October with these engaging content ideas:

• Share daily Halloween-themed jokes, puns, and memes
• Post Halloween riddles for followers to solve in the comments
• Create Halloween-themed polls ("Vampire or Werewolf?", "Chocolate or Gummy sweets?")
• Share "This or That" Halloween edition posts
• Ask followers about their biggest childhood fears
• Create Halloween trivia quizzes with small prizes for winners

Behind-the-Scenes Spooky Content

Team & Workplace Halloween Fun

Your audience loves seeing the human side of your business. Try these ideas:

• Show your team members in their Halloween costumes
• Share photos of office Halloween decorations
• Create short videos of staff re-enacting scenes from classic horror films
• Post about your team's Halloween lunch or party preparations
• Share "then and now" Halloween photos of long-time employees
• Document your workplace Halloween transformation process

Promotional & Sales-Focused Halloween Ideas

Limited-Time Halloween Offers

Create urgency and drive immediate sales with these promotional strategies:

• Launch Halloween countdown sales with daily deals leading up to 31st October
• Offer "Scary Good" discount codes with Halloween-themed names
• Create "Trick or Treat" promotions where customers receive surprise bonuses or discounts
• Design flash sales that last only on Halloween day
• Offer early bird discounts for customers who shop before Halloween week
• Create bundle deals with Halloween-themed product combinations

Product Integration Ideas

• Redesign existing product packaging with Halloween themes for a limited time
• Create special Halloween product combos named after popular characters (Frankenstein's Bundle, Witch's Collection, etc.)
• Showcase customers using your products during Halloween celebrations
• Develop Halloween gift guides featuring your products
• Create seasonal how-to content showing Halloween uses for your products

Industry-Specific Halloween Marketing Ideas

For Retail & Fashion Businesses

• Feature costume showcases with themed photoshoots
• Share daily "Outfit of the Day" Halloween inspiration
• Create Halloween makeup tutorials using products you sell
• Showcase Halloween accessories and seasonal collections
• Partner with local costume shops for cross-promotion

For Food & Beverage Establishments

• Offer spooky specials with limited-time Halloween menu items
• Share Halloween recipe ideas using your ingredients
• Create video tutorials for Halloween treats and drinks
• Host virtual cooking classes for Halloween-themed dishes
• Feature Halloween-themed cocktails and mocktails with creative names

For Service-Based Businesses

• Create Halloween-themed versions of your regular services
• Share tips for incorporating Halloween themes into your industry
• Offer Halloween consultation packages or workshops
• Partner with complementary businesses for Halloween events
• Create educational content about Halloween safety in your field

Quick Implementation Tips

Planning Your Halloween Content

• Start planning your Halloween content at least 3-4 weeks in advance
• Create a content calendar specifically for October
• Batch create content to ensure consistent posting
• Prepare backup content for busy periods
• Set aside time for engaging with comments and responses

Measuring Success

Track these key metrics to measure your Halloween campaign success:

• Engagement rate (likes, comments, shares)
• Reach and impressions
• Website traffic from social media
• Conversion rates during Halloween period
• User-generated content submissions
• Hashtag performance

Making It Work for Your Business

Remember, not every idea will work for every business. Choose the content types that align with your brand personality and audience preferences. Start with 5-10 ideas that feel most natural for your business, then expand based on what performs well.
